Garlic Chili Oil Noodles

A quick vegan delight perfect for busy nights, packed with flavor from garlic, scallions, and chili flakes.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 25 minutes
Servings: 2 servings
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: Asian, Vegan
Calories: 400

Ingredients
  

For the Noodles
  • 200 grams Noodles (Any type like spaghetti or udon)
For the Sauce
  • 3 tablespoons Cooking Oil (Neutral oil for sautéing)
  • 2 stalks White Scallion (Substitute with chopped onion if necessary)
  • 4 cloves Minced Garlic (Fresh or jarred)
  • 1 cup Vegetable Broth (Can use chicken broth or water as alternatives)
  • 2 tablespoons Light Soy Sauce (Tamari is a gluten-free substitute)
  • 1 tablespoon Dark Soy Sauce (Additional light soy can replace it)
  • 1 tablespoon Chinese Black Vinegar (Rice vinegar is a suitable alternative)
  • 1 tablespoon Korean Chili Flakes (Adjust to spice preference)
For Garnishing
  • 2 tablespoons Green Scallion (Chopped)
  • 1 tablespoon Toasted Sesame Seeds (Optional but recommended)

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Begin by cooking the noodles according to the package instructions. Drain and set aside.
  2. In a large skillet, heat the cooking oil over medium heat.
  3. Add the white scallion and minced garlic to the skillet. Sauté until fragrant, about 1-2 minutes.
  4. Pour in the vegetable broth, light soy sauce, dark soy sauce, Chinese black vinegar, and Korean chili flakes. Stir well to combine.
  5. Bring the sauce to a simmer. Allow it to cook for about 3-5 minutes to blend the flavors.
  6. Add the cooked noodles to the skillet. Toss them in the sauce until fully coated.
  7. Remove from heat and garnish with chopped green scallions and toasted sesame seeds.

Tips to Make Garlic Chili Oil Noodles Perfect

  • Noodle Choice: Feel free to try different types of noodles. While spaghetti and udon work great, rice noodles or soba can provide a unique twist.
  • Add Vegetables: Toss in some quick-cooking vegetables like snap peas, bell peppers, or broccoli for added nutrition and color.
  • Spice Level: Adjust the amount of Korean chili flakes based on your spice tolerance. Start small, and you can always add more later.
  • Garnishing: Don’t skip the toasted sesame seeds; they add a lovely nutty flavor and texture to the dish.

Flavor Variations

Experiment with different flavors to create your perfect dish. For instance, you can substitute the Korean chili flakes with chili oil for a different kind of heat. Adding a small amount of hoisin sauce can also introduce a sweet and savory element that complements the noodles nicely.

Pro Tips for Success

  • Sautéing Garlic: Keep an eye on the garlic while sautéing. It can burn quickly, which will result in a bitter taste.
  • Fresh Ingredients: Using fresh ingredients will significantly enhance the flavor of your dish. Try using freshly minced garlic instead of pre-minced.
  • Sauce Consistency: If your sauce is too thick, simply add more vegetable broth to reach the desired consistency.

FAQs About Garlic Chili Oil Noodles

Can I make Garlic Chili Oil Noodles gluten-free?

Yes, you can easily make this dish gluten-free. Use gluten-free noodles and tamari instead of light soy sauce.

What can I serve with Garlic Chili Oil Noodles?

These noodles are versatile! You can pair them with a fresh salad, steamed veggies, or even some vegetable dumplings for a fuller meal.

How can I adjust the spice level?

If you prefer a milder flavor, start with less Korean chili flakes. You can always add more to your serving for a personalized kick.
